Think of Biblically Responsible Investing (BRI) as Socially Responsible Investing with a Christian values application. It is the process of aligning investment portfolios with your values as a Bible believing Christian.
Maybe you have not thought about the fact that many of your investment holdings either produce and/or market products that go against your Christian convictions or support causes that do. Or maybe you just did not think there was anything you could do about this conundrum. Well, there is an option. You can align your investments with your beliefs.
Biblically Responsible Investing screens for companies engaged (manufacturing, sales, or activism) in pornography, tobacco, marijuana, human rights, gambling, abortion, LGBQT, persecution of Christians and other religious minorities, etc. The filtering process also looks for companies that support and fund causes such as “420” (the annual marijuana celebrations), sex reassignment surgery, pro-abortion activities, and more.
The Biblical Responsible Investing Institute has identified corporate violations of sixty or more activities that should be of concern to Christian investors. While Christian do not want to support these activities with their investment funds that does not mean we do not care about the individuals involved corporately or individually.
The goal is for Christian investors to be good and wise stewards with the money that God has entrusted them to manage. Not surprisingly, some companies have changed their activism and marketing based on pressure from BRI manager influence.
Christians do not have to sacrifice long-term returns to remove “bad companies” from their investment portfolio. The goal is not necessarily to outperform your current portfolio but obtain similar returns via portfolios aligned with your Christian beliefs and values.
